What to Look for in a Data Analytics Partner
Choosing the right analytics company is about more than technical skill. The best providers combine strong data engineering foundations with clear communication, industry knowledge, and a focus on measurable outcomes. Key qualities include experience with modern cloud platforms, expertise in visualisation tools, robust data governance practices, and the ability to translate insights into plain business language.
Buyers in Bolton should also consider whether a partner offers ongoing support rather than one-off reports. The most valuable relationships are built on continuous improvement, where dashboards evolve, models are retrained, and new questions are answered as the business grows.

Industry Trends Shaping Analytics in Bolton
Several trends are influencing how Bolton companies approach data. Cloud adoption continues to accelerate, allowing even small businesses to access enterprise-grade analytics without heavy infrastructure costs. Self-service dashboards are empowering non-technical staff to explore data independently, while automated reporting frees analysts to focus on higher-value questions.
Artificial intelligence and machine learning are also becoming more accessible. Local providers increasingly offer predictive maintenance, demand forecasting, and customer churn models as standard services rather than premium add-ons. At the same time, data privacy and governance remain top priorities, with responsible handling of personal information now central to every credible provider's offering.

Common Questions About Data Analytics
Business owners in Bolton often ask how much data they need before analytics becomes worthwhile. The reassuring answer is that even modest datasets, such as sales records, website visits, or customer feedback, can yield valuable insights when analysed properly. Analytics is not reserved for large corporations; small businesses frequently see the fastest returns because a single clear insight can reshape their operations.
Another frequent question concerns cost and complexity. Modern cloud tools have dramatically lowered both, and reputable Bolton providers offer flexible engagements ranging from short audits to fully managed services. The key is to start with a specific business question rather than trying to analyse everything at once. This focused approach delivers quicker wins, builds internal confidence, and creates momentum for more ambitious projects as the organisation matures.
